In a time when 3D models and immersive virtual reality applications influence conversations about the fields of construction, architecture, and design, it’s easy for people to ignore the value of 2D drawing. However, 2D drafting remains a fundamental element in the construction and design process that provides clarity, high quality, and simplicity that modern technologies can make. From floor plans and construction blueprints, 2D drafting continues to be a vital element to ensure efficient project execution. It is crucially important in the beginning phases of Designing and Drafting where clarity on the conceptual level is essential.

The value of 2D draftsmanship lies in its capacity to express complicated designs simply and understandably for everyone. Unlike 3D models, which often require specific software and technical know-how to interpret, 2D drawings are accessible to a wide range of stakeholders—engineers, contractors, architects, and clients alike. They provide accurate diagrams of buildings as well as layouts, systems, and structures, which makes them essential equipment to use in any building or renovation project.

Clarity and Simplicity in Communication

One of the biggest benefits of 2D draftsmanship is its capacity to communicate clearly. The 2D sketch strips a plan to its fundamentals and eliminates unnecessary complications. This is especially beneficial when planning the initial phases of the project as well as field implementation. Electricians, builders, and plumbers depend on 2D drawings to make precise measurements, spatial relations, and placement of components.

Communication errors can cost you money in construction. Incorrectly interpreting the details of an intricate 3D rendering could cause incorrect installation, delay, rework, or delays. Contrarily, 2D drafting minimizes such dangers by providing standard symbolism, clearly defined notations, and consistent scaling, which every worker on the job is aware of.

Time-Tested Precision

While 3D modeling is more complex and popular, 2D drafting remains the standard used by the industry to document official approval and documentation procedures. Numerous municipal agencies and regulators have 2D blueprints required to permit inspections and permits. It is easy to understand why: 2D drawings are unbeatable in accuracy and clarity in the legal realm.

With precise measurements, materials, and tolerances drawn in 2D, contractors can complete their tasks without confusion. When it comes to cutting sheetrock for an opening or installing conduits for electrical wiring, exact measurements on the 2D diagram guide each task. Additionally, as they are typically standardized, they help reduce errors as well as ensure uniformity across trades.

Integration into Modern Tools

It’s not outdated; 2D drafting has evolved with technological advances. Nowadays, drafters utilize sophisticated CAD (Computer Aided Design) software that produces extremely precise and accurate drawings. The tools enable rapid revisions, a better arrangement of layers, and effortless integration into Building Information Modeling (BIM) software.

In this environment of hybridization, 2D drafting complements 3D modeling and does not compete with it. Although 3D models provide visual benefits, 2D drafting brings precision as well as documents. In the case of contractors, they may use the 3D model in order to envision the kitchen they are building, but they’ll utilize the 2D design to calculate the dimensions of cabinets along with electrical outlets as well as the placement of plumbing.

Cost-Effectiveness and Accessibility

Another benefit that comes with 2D drawing is cost-effectiveness. The creation of 2D plans usually takes less time and energy than more complex 3D designs, which could cost a lot of resources and be costly. For clients with smaller budgets or projects who have limited funds, 2D drawing is an economical yet secure option.

In addition, 2D files are easier to print, share, and store. Plans and blueprints can be checked on-site without the need to use specialized equipment or software. For areas that have limited access to advanced technology, drawings in 2D help ensure that work continues seamlessly without compromise on quality or precision.

Supporting Specialized Trades

2D drawing plays a vital role in coordination among specialized trades like plumbing, electrical, HVAC, and millwork. Drawings of the shop are precise to ensure that each piece of equipment fits in the bigger structure, eliminating clashes and expensive rework. For millwork, for instance, complex details like the cabinetry joints, patterns for veneer, and hardware locations are laid out precisely.

Utilizing precise 2D drafting, millworkers are able to create pieces according to precise specifications, thus reducing waste and making sure that the piece is perfectly sized for the installation.
